2008 Boston Red Sox season


The 2008 Boston Red Sox season was the 108th season in the franchise's Major League Baseball history. The Red Sox, as [2007 Boston Boston Red Sox|Red Sox season|the defending World Series champions], finished in second place in the American League East with a record of 95–67, two games behind the Tampa Bay Rays. The Red Sox qualified for the postseason as the AL wild card and defeated the American League West champion Los Angeles Angels of Anaheim in the ALDS. The Red Sox then lost to the Rays in the ALCS in seven games. This was the franchise's fourth appearance in the ALCS in six seasons.
In late March, the team started the regular season playing in Tokyo against the Oakland Athletics for MLB Japan Opening Day 2008. In July, seven Red Sox players were selected for the AL All-Star team, with outfielder J. D. Drew being named the game's MVP. On July 31, the Red Sox traded long-time star player Manny Ramirez to the Dodgers in a three-way blockbuster for Jason Bay and minor leaguer Josh Wilson. In September, the team officially retired uniform number 6 in honor of Johnny Pesky.

Regular season

Prior to the season, three large Coca-Cola bottles, which had been placed on the left light tower above the Green Monster prior to the 1997 season as an advertisement, were removed.
